Question
what was a major social effect of the industrial revolution?
a. populations spread more evenly between rural and urban.
b. access to education decreased for middle - class families.
c. the gap between the rich and the poor grew larger.
d. more workers than ever were required to produce food.
During the Industrial Revolution, factory owners and capitalists (the rich) accumulated vast wealth. Workers (the poor) faced long hours, poor working conditions, and low wages. This led to a widening gap between the rich and the poor.
- Option A: Urban areas grew rapidly as people moved for factory jobs, so populations did not spread evenly.
- Option B: Access to education increased for some as there was a need for more literate workers in certain industries and a growing middle - class interest in education.
- Option D: Mechanization in agriculture reduced the number of workers needed to produce food.
